Hon’ble Mrs. Sangeeta Chandra, J.—The dispute in this bunch of writ petitions relates to validity of the notification issued by the Election Commission of India-respondent No. 2 dated 13th January, 2014 and the Press Note dated 4th January, 2017 with regard to the reservation of Assembly Constituency No. 402 Obra and Assembly Constituency No. 403 Dudhi, both in District Sonbhadra for Scheduled Tribes and a prayer has been made for issuance of a mandamus to treat the aforesaid seats as before the notification dated 13th January, 2014 with Obra as unreserved and Dudhi as reserved for Scheduled Castes only. The petitioners allege that they are engaged in active politics and were thinking of contesting the election from these Assembly Constituencies so announced for Uttar Pradesh Vidhan Sabha on 4th January, 2017, but due to the declaration of these two constituencies as reserved for Scheduled Tribes, their nominations for election shall not be entertained and they will be illegally and arbitrarily deprived of exercise of their statutory right for contesting the elections under the Representation of People Act, 1950.
